The application of Concrete Ciré is hugely popular in homes, commercial buildings, hotels, restaurants and retail properties. Not only because of the unique character and luxurious appearance of the material, but also because of its versatility.
This is because cementitious stucco is durable, waterproof, hard-wearing, seamless and adheres to virtually any surface. From wood, stone and concrete to drywall, ceramic tile, plastics and glass. Moreover, the material can be applied to any location: from floors to ceilings, walls, stairs and furniture, and from living and work spaces to kitchens and bathrooms. Even an application in the shower is no problem at all, says Patrick Vos, director of Beton Aparte International, the official importer and distributor of Beton Ciré in the Netherlands, Belgium and Germany.
Beton Ciré is a waterproof concrete stucco that has been used in bathrooms in France for more than 25 years, Vos says. "This Beton Ciré, rubbed concrete in French, used to be kept waterproof with wax or oil. Today, however, we have permanent systems that remain waterproof, easy to clean and very hygienic. In fact, because of the seamless application, dirt, mold and bacteria are not an issue."
In addition to cement, Beton Ciré consists of very finely ground pebbles and sand and special synthetic resin (resin). This synthetic resin makes the product flexible yet hard, allowing it to be applied very thinly (max. 2 mm).
"Because Concrete Ciré is applied by hand, it can be processed in any way desired. It can be roughly placed, sanded and/or polished smooth. In addition, it can be worked with one or more colors."
Using a dye, the product can be supplied in any color, Vos says. "We have 74 standard colors. In addition, we make custom colors for architects and designers, which are not reproduced."
The complete Beton Ciré system from Beton Aparte also includes an impregnating agent for basic protection and adhesion of the sealer, as well as a special 2-component PU Sealer mat for kitchen or bathroom applications.
"In addition to the above products, today we work a lot with geopolymers; a sustainable and green alternative to cement," Vos says. "This binder consists mainly of high-quality secondary minerals, extracted from industrial residues and with a low CO2 footprint and environmental footprint. With this, we match the sustainability ambitions of many customers."
